Bond No. 9 is a New York-based niche house known for its location-specific fragrances that capture different neighborhoods and landmarks across Manhattan. Secret Gardens, released in 2015, is part of their signature collection and reflects the brand's approach to creating evocative, place-inspired scents.

Secret Gardens opens with a spicy hit of saffron that immediately signals warmth and richness. The heart reveals a creamy white floral blend of jasmine and orchid, layered over sandalwood for a soft, woody elegance. The base settles into amber and sandalwood, creating a powdery, musky finish that lingers close to the skin. The overall profile leans heavily on warm spice and creamy florals, grounded by woody and amber accords, making it a sophisticated take on the white floral genre.

This fragrance suits anyone drawn to creamy, spiced florals with depth rather than bright freshness. It works well across seasons but particularly shines in cooler months when its warmth feels most natural. The powdery-musky base means it won't project loudly, so it's ideal for intimate settings or office-appropriate wear. Are grey market retailers authentic?

Yes. Jomashop, FragranceNet, and MaxAroma sell 100% authentic Bond No. 9 fragrances through unofficial distribution channels. The fragrance is identical to department store stock. Grey market refers to the supply chain, not product quality. The price difference comes entirely from the distribution channel.
